This is a straightforward adventure story, but very well told. The picture of an elderly dwarf smoking a pipe by the fire, and regaling his beardless grandchildren with stories of his youth is unshakeable, and I found myself reading bits of it aloud just to savor the sound of his voice.

The story is briskly told without feelign rushed. My only nitpick is that the gaffer says more or less twice "it took me a while to figure out what really happened". Since he has no intention of telling us now, repeating it within a 2 paragraph span is annoying to the reader. Smiley

Still, I'd not mind more stories from this old dwarf.
